Boeing Enterprise Product Security Engineering (PSE) is seeking a Senior Manager - Product Security Engineering People & Talent Leader to lead our Workforce People and Talent plans and activities across our Businesses.
This position is available in one of the following locations: Seattle, WA, Arlington, VA, Aurora, CO, Berkeley, MO, Colorado Springs, CO, El Segundo, CA, Everett, WA, Hazelwood, MO, Huntington Beach, CA, Huntsville, AL, Mesa, AZ, Oklahoma City, OK, or Ridley Park, PA.
The selected leader will be assigned to the Enterprise PSE Workforce Leader to partner with Business PSE leaders and engineering managers to define and align strategies to "Attract, Develop, Deploy, and Retain" a highly skilled, diverse, and motivated PSE workforce. The leader will have a strong passion for people development and engagement. The leader will collaborate with functional engineering partners in other engineering disciplines, with peer managers in other business units, and with HR and finance partners to ensure our staffing processes, development resources, manager tools, and engagement materials align with Enterprise Engineering's mission to deliver world class engineering.
The selected candidate will collaborate with executive and management at all levels across Businesses and PSE capabilities, HR Business Partners, and Enterprise Engineering to develop strategies and execution plans.
Position Responsibilities:
Responsible for establishing and executing functional staffing strategy and plans of action to achieve business PSE resource demands, for near- and long-term priorities, partnering with business PSE management and skills teams to execute and attract, develop, deploy, and retain
Responsible for establishing and deploying consistent functional strategy and staffing processes and plans, to include external hiring environment and strategy, in partnership with Business PSE, Workforce, Business and Program Leaders, and HR
Collaborate with PSE Executives and PSE Managers to ensure alignment and deployment of Best Practices [e.g. Early Career hiring initiatives, selection of Boeing Designated Expert (BDE) and Technical Lead Engineers (TLE), Technical Mentoring Program, and technical skills development]
Represent and make workforce strategy and plan related decisions actions on behalf of the Product Security Engineering Capability leadership, in various forums
Responsible for leading regular engagements with PSE Managers to ensure staffing and promotion processes and development resources are clearly understood
Establish and maintain an operation rhythm for unified resource forecasting and staffing, ensure planning is complete and includes a sourcing strategy for Boeing employees, contract labor, and purchased services that meets skilled workforce demand near and long term
Lead acquisition and utilization of PSE talent by understanding program needs/priorities including detailed program and skill sourcing to ensure risk mitigation on staffing needs occurs
Develop and implement strategies for acquisition of employees with US government security clearances, early career and professional hiring (aligned to Enterprise strategies), and for technical fellow utilization and needs
Build the Boeing brand as an employer of choice for PSE through collaboration with external professional affiliations and engagement with Boeing Business Resource Groups
